Summary: | This report describes the first attempt to associate the area of discrete aurora observed in a DMSP image with simultaneous measurements of auroral kilometric radiation (AKR) power flux at 178 and 311 kHz. This article is from 'Proceedings of the Air Force Geophysics Laboratory Workshop on Natural Charging of Large Space Structures in Near Earth Polar Orbit: 14-15 September 1982,' AD-A134 894, p157-162. |
